Abstract
This work presents spatial and temporal change of optical properties of aerosols over Japan and Western Australia. The measurements by a portable multi-spectral polarimeter (PSR-1000) from 1997 to 2000 provide the optical thickness of aerosols and the Ångström exponent. For comparison, the same aerosol parameters are derived from the satellite data, e.g. ADEOS / POLDER and/or SeaWiFS data. It is shown that the obtained results from the space-based data are validated with the results from the ground measurements on a local scale, and the retrieved aerosol characteristics exhibit each intrinsic feature for each region.
